For energy efficient and high performance design, the low power VLSI circuit is used. Multiplier is an essential part of low power VLSI design, since the efficiency of the digital signal processor depends upon the Multiplier. Multiplier requires more hardware resources and processing time than addition and subtraction process. In multiplier circuit, most of the power is dissipated across in full adder circuits. In this paper, a detailed analysis of different types of Multiplier has been studied. The effectiveness and efficiency of these multipliers are stated in terms of performance measures such as Area, Power and Maximum delay.
